Managing Large Seed Collections
Having hundreds of seeds can feel exciting, but it can quickly become overwhelming. Without a clear plan, your garden may become overcrowded and inefficient.
A better approach includes planting in smaller batches and removing underperforming crops. This keeps your garden manageable and ensures that valuable plants have enough space to grow.

Avoiding Lag and Overcrowding
One common issue players face is lag caused by too many plants. When your garden is overloaded, performance drops and gameplay becomes frustrating.
To avoid this:
Regularly clear unnecessary plants.
Maintain a balanced layout.
Avoid planting everything at once.
This ensures smooth gameplay and better overall efficiency.
Selling and Reinvesting
Selling your harvest regularly is key to maintaining progress. A full inventory can slow you down and prevent you from planting new seeds.
Reinvesting your earnings into better seeds allows for continuous improvement and keeps your garden evolving.
